Transaction 91088e513013688b494b4421409e1740b24cf4d4840af68e4d47fa863c7ca76f
3 Input
2 Outputs
- 91088e513013688b494b4421409e1740b24cf4d4840af68e4d47fa863c7ca76f:0
- 91088e513013688b494b4421409e1740b24cf4d4840af68e4d47fa863c7ca76f:1
value 8740
address 1DzMKo3WNF1nbSL3KEPMEN5i7ujpyKrmAu
value 150145388
address 3F1uLf5eH1Tj3eMkCrvYbivkYxiu6xTjXN